What are brake rotors, and why are they important?
Brake rotors are essential components for your Ford's braking system. They work in conjunction with the brake pads to create friction, which slows down and stops the wheels. How do I know if the brake rotors on my Ford need to be replaced?
Common signs include squeaking or grinding noises when braking, vibration or pulsation in the brake pedal, or visible grooves and warping on the rotors. It’s essential to inspect the rotors on your Ford regularly to ensure they are not excessively worn or damaged. How often should I replace the brake rotors on my Ford?
The replacement interval for your vehicle depends on your driving habits, the type of vehicle, and the quality of the brake components. Typically, rotors can last anywhere between 30,000 to 70,000 miles.
Can I replace just the brake pads without replacing the rotors?
Yes, in some cases, you can replace only the brake pads if the rotors on your Ford are still in good condition. However, if the rotors are excessively worn, warped, or damaged, they should be replaced or resurfaced simultaneously to ensure proper braking performance.
